Someone shot a car on Ansonia’s Lester Street late Saturday.
Police said the incident happened at about 11:50 p.m.
No one was injured. The car was shot once, according to Ansonia police spokesman Lt. Andrew Cota.
Police do not have any suspects or witnesses at this time.
The shooting happened shortly after a separate disturbance on Main Street.
Police do not believe the two incidents are related.
At about 11:30 p.m., a large party left Planet Eris coffee shop on Main Street and several teens caused a disturbance on the street, Cota said.
One teen — Howard Rumley, 19, of Derby — was charged with breach of peace and interfering. Rumley was released on a $1,000 bond.
Lester Street and Main Street are on opposite sides of the Naugatuck River.
